Mission: To inculcate the principles of Charity, Justice, Brotherly Love and Fidelity; to recognize a belief in God; to promote the welfare and enhance the happiness of its Members; to quicken the spirit of American patriotism; to cultivate good fellowship; to perpetuate itself as a fraternal organization, and to provide for its government, the Benevolent and Protective Order of Elks of the United States of America will serve the people and communities through benevolent programs, demonstrating that Elks Care and Elks Share. Improve community relations, provide leadership, and promote youth organization and development. The Elks have have been community leaders since March 15, 1868 and are still an important part of society. We provide college scholarships for tomorrows leaders today and are active participants in important youth development organizations such as the Boy Scouts of America among others.
